TURN-208: Gatevale turnstile counters at the Merrow Field pilot double-count when a rotation reverses mid-cycle. Attendance totals drift roughly 2% high per event. The debounce window fix is implemented, reviewed by Ilsa, and soak-tested across two simulated match days without drift. Ready for your cut; the candidate build is identified below.

trace token, tagag-tafog: htk6_5ed18c

Break-glass access — Tumblequay laundry lockers. If a resident reports a stuck locker and the normal unlock flow fails, support may trigger emergency release through the operator console. This bypasses the booking check, so log the locker number and reason in the incident channel first. The break-glass console requires the shared recovery account; to authenticate, enter the recovery passphrase below.

unlock words, hahip-baduf: holwyn-istath-julvan

// Pricing experiment: "Duskfare" dynamic ticket tiers.
// Security note: these multipliers only adjust display price; the
// checkout service in Tollgate re-validates against the canonical
// rate card, so tampering here can't produce undercharges. Rollout
// is gated by the Larkspur flag service per venue. Experiment ends
// when the holdout converges. The tunable constants follow.

tuning table, yajog-yahof:
BUDGETS = {
    "lamvan": 303,
    "wenox": 460,
    "fenvan": 525,
}